This stubby but beefy yard switcher, CNJ 0-6-0 #136, was built by the Baldwin Locomotive Works in April of 1918. In 1945, the loco was reclassified as class 6538. In October of 1952, the loco was sold for scrap after nearly 34 years of service. Limited specs - 51" drivers, 22x26" cylinders. No date or photographer was listed for this photo. |
